Wenger – Arsenal are still in the title race

Posted on December 28, 2012 by admin

Having seen his Arsenal team finally win three League matches in a row, Arsene Wenger firmly believes that the Gunners could easily catch up with Man United at the top of the League if they could how a little more consistency.

Wenger said: “It is down to consistency,”

“Christmas showed us that Chelsea and Manchester City are not out of reach. The team that is consistent with their results will get there.

“Man United don’t look out of reach if you look at the way the games go. But again they manage to win at home in the last minute. They have the quality to score goals but they do concede so it is open. But at the moment they are the most consistent.”

Although Arsenal only beat Wigan last week by a single penalty, Wenger was very pleased with the commitment shown by the team. He continued: “It was an important three points because they [Wigan] came into the game on the back of an important win at Reading. For us to have two away wins just before playing at home over Christmas was vital.

“We were less impressive than we had been at Reading going forward but we were well organised and disciplined. So it was good to get the three points with this type of performance.

“We have built a team who showed fantastic promise at the start but have stuttered a little bit. Now there is a block of unity and understanding. They know the way to play. That can give us the consistency between January and May.”

Arsenal are currently in 7th place but with a game in hand on most teams above us. If we are going to really challenge for the title we really need to win our next few games first! Bring on Newcastle!
